Team Fortress 2 Updates Hitting Xbox 360 At A Price

by Mike Bendel on August 22, 2008 @ 9:46 am


Speaking to Kotaku at this year’s Leipzig Games Convention, Valve marketing head Doug Lombardi revealed that the company is prepping a sizable content update pack for the Xbox 360 edition of Team Fortress 2. Included in the downloadable update will be all of the goodies PC owners of the game have been enjoying, such as new gameplay modes, maps, as well as new unlockable weapons and abilities for the Pyro, Medic and Heavy set of character classes.

The only caveat? Unlike on the PC, it won’t be free, due to Microsoft’s mandatory policy of requiring to charge for additional DLC. Good thing is, Valve wants to keep the price as low as possible, somewhere in the range of $10 dollars.

Valve has no plans at this time to release the same update for PlayStation 3 owners. That ball is likely in EA’s court, as they handled development duties on the PS3 version.
